Why Custom WordPress Themes Are Better Than Pre-Made Templates

27. Apr 2025
2 mins read

When it comes to building a WordPress website, one major decision is choosing between a custom-built theme and a pre-made template. While templates offer a quick start, custom themes deliver long-term success.

Unique Design That Matches Your Brand

Pre-made templates often feel generic and recycled across many websites. Custom themes are tailored to your brand identity, ensuring your website stands out and delivers a cohesive user experience.

Better Performance and Speed

Custom themes are built with only the necessary features, resulting in faster load times compared to bloated templates packed with unnecessary code.

Full Control Over Functionality

With a custom theme, you decide exactly how your website behaves. This flexibility allows you to create unique features that meet your specific business needs.

SEO Optimization from the Ground Up

Custom themes allow developers to implement SEO best practices at the core level, making your site faster, cleaner, and easier to rank on search engines.

Long-Term Scalability

As your business grows, so do your website needs. Custom themes are much easier to scale and adapt, ensuring your website evolves alongside your goals.
